Abstract

To identify the animal species which take fruits from the ground we placed and automatic camera system under a tree form which fruits were falling in Pasoh Forest Reserve. Of 2 738 picture obtained showing species visiting the tree for fruit 93.3 percent were mammals consisting of 25 species and others were birds (8 species) and reptiles (2 species). The pigtailed macaque long-tailed porcupine long-tailed giant rat three-striped ground squirrel red spiny rat banded leaf monkey and common porcupine were dominant visitors accounting for 89.3 percent of all pictures of mammals. Activity patterns of the major mammals bases on visiting time deduced from the pictures were examined. Effects of frugivory of animals on mortality of seeds and dispersal of seeds are discussed.
